AGRITX
Statesville, US · Founded 2025 · 3 known investors
AgriTX develops AGRITX-F65, a proprietary blend of pre/probiotics, vitamins, amino acids, and minerals applied to the eggshell microbiome of fertilized avian eggs to improve hatch rates, chick quality, and livability. The product targets poultry producers and broiler breeder operations in the agricultural biotech space.
